# Build Provenance — Ladleworks Scaler

New folks: Ladleworks Scaler, our recipe-scaling calculator, is built exclusively through the Copperkettle pipeline. No local builds ever ship. Each run pins the toolchain, hashes every dependency, and writes a provenance attestation alongside the artifact. If you're verifying a deployed version, compare its embedded stamp to the release ledger. Every support request about scaling math should start by confirming the identifier that follows.

session token of tajef-bageg = htk21_5d90d574934f3ccae6437

Finance Review Summary — Q3, Larkspool Services. Quick read for branch managers: the new Meridian Plus subscription tier is outperforming forecasts, up roughly 18% on sign-ups versus plan. Margins look healthy once onboarding costs settle. Watch for cannibalisation of the basic tier — early signs only. Keep pushing upgrades at renewal. The broader play behind this tier is set out below.

board note of fahif-yahog: Gross margin on Wenath came in at 10 percent against a plan of 5 percent. Only 3 of the 100 pilot accounts renewed Wenath, so a churn review is set for July 15.

Subject: Stormrelay fan-out cut-over — summary for security review

Hi — quick wrap-up on last night's cut-over of the Stormrelay weather-alert fan-out. We moved from the legacy broadcaster to the new queue-backed dispatcher at 03:15, and severe-alert delivery latency dropped nicely. For your review: all publisher credentials were rotated during the window, the old endpoints are dark, and mutual TLS is enforced on every downstream hop. Nothing spicy in the logs so far. The dispatcher's production configuration, as deployed, is below.

settings of yaguf-bahip:
druwyn:
  log_level: debug
  metrics_host: metrics.druwyn.qorvelsys.internal
  pool_size: 32

Break-Glass Access: Nightly Search Reindex (Project Millbrook)

Support team: if the reindex job stalls past 03:00 and the scheduler is unreachable, break-glass access is authorized. Document the timestamp and notify the duty lead afterward. The reindex controller will prompt for emergency credentials before accepting a manual restart. When prompted, authenticate with the recovery passphrase below.

vault phrase of bagaf-kajeg = jorath-feniel-briir-siliel-ralix